1c1d09d858 fix(athena): prevent recursive council explosion — deny tool for bg tasks + dedup guard
Council members launched as agent='athena' got Athena's system prompt saying
'ALWAYS call athena_council first', plus the tool wasn't denied for bg athena
tasks. Each council member spawned 4 more → exponential explosion (47+ tasks).

Three fixes:
1. Deny athena_council in ATHENA_RESTRICTIONS (agent-tool-restrictions.ts)
   - Only affects background athena tasks (task-starter.ts)
   - Primary Athena (user-selected) still has access via permission field
2. Session-level dedup guard prevents re-calling while council is running
   - If Athena retries during long wait, returns 'already running'
3. Increase wait timeout from 2min to 10min (council members need time
   for real code analysis with Read/Grep/LSP)

121e1cb879 fix(delegate-task): aggressive tool description to prevent missing category/subagent_type
Problem: Agents frequently omit both 'category' and 'subagent_type' parameters
when calling the task() tool, causing validation failures. The JSON Schema
marks both as optional, and LLMs follow schema structure over description text.

Solution (Option A): Add aggressive visual warnings and failure-mode examples
to the tool description:
- ⚠️ CRITICAL warning header
- COMMON MISTAKE example showing what will FAIL
- CORRECT examples for both category and subagent_type usage
- Clear explanation that ONE must be provided

Tests: All 153 existing tests pass (no behavior change, only prompt improvement)
